Establishment of the Water Resilience Trust Fund under the Water Financing Partnership Facility
The proposed Water Resilience Trust Fund will be a multi-donor trust fund to strengthen water resilience in ADB’s developing member countries (DMCs).
Activities to be supported by the Water Resilience Trust Fund include (i) policy dialogue and sector reforms, (ii) sector diagnostics, (iii) knowledge management, (iv) innovation and proof of concept, and (v) sovereign and nonsovereign project design and implementation support.
